Identifying Your Target Market
Before diving into B2B exports, it is essential to conduct thorough market research. Analyze different regions and identify where your products are in demand. Tools such as trade statistics and market analysis reports can provide valuable insights.

Complying with Export Regulations
Export regulations can vary significantly between countries. It’s critical to familiarize yourself with compliance requirements, including tariffs, documentation, and trade laws, to ensure smooth operations.
